Love Poem on a Day I Don't Feel Like Writing a Love Poem

Luisa A. Igloria

Nov 9

Because I thought I'd wake to another day of just drowning, all talk with no heed for consequence, all rancor and lies,  I made myself chop garlic and onions until I felt the sting in my eyes. I stripped lengths of fiber   from celery, skin from carrots. With my hands I churned an egg and a half cup of milk into a bowl   of cold ground meat, feeling a glistening  resistance even from these things that have   basically no more life. Yet, free of gristle and fat,  dressed with oil, salt, and bay leaf— I can shape   them into loaves or slice them into rounds.  The air in my house is warm as the inside of a barn,   thick with the steam of effort. I am neither  happy nor unhappy. This work has merely fixed   me here, where I think about who will eat what I made, carefully following the steps, all morning.
